Leave No Trace

Leave No Trace

Public Services & Government in Boulder, CO

Public Services & Government Environment Issues

Contact us

Location

1830 17th St., 100
Boulder , CO 80302 UNITED STATES

Reviews

Leave No Trace 303-442-8222
1830 17th St., 100
Boulder , CO 80302 UNITED STATES
$
Leave No Trace

Detail information

Company name
Leave No Trace
Category
Public Services & Government
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Leave No Trace

Contacts Location Details